1. Two drugs, A and B, are entirely eliminated through the kidney by glomerular filtration (120 mL/min), with no reabsorption. Drug A has half the distribution volume of drug B, and the VD of drug B is 15 L. What are the drug clearances for each drug based on the classical and physiologic approaches?
2.It was determined that 95% of an oral 80-mg dose of verapamil was absorbed in a 70 kg test subject. However, because of extensive biotransformation during its first pass through the portal circulation, the bioavailability of verapamil was only 25%. Assuming a liver blood flow of 1500 mL/min, determine the hepatic clearance of verapamil in this situation.
